Mineralogy and geochemistry of immature lateritic crusts discriminating granitoids and Cr-Ni-bearings ultramafic rocks in southeastern Carajás

Abstract: Lateritic formations with iron crusts are very frequent in the Amazon. They, in addition to their great importance in containing a large part of the most voluminous ores (iron, manganese, bauxite and kaolin), may be valuable proxies for paleoclimatic reconstitution. In the Carajás region, the oldest lateritic formations are well represented on the high surface (plateaus) and the youngest on the low landscape.
